This book was called " The Wargod Consort Has Many Ruthless Words ". The characters in the book included the male protagonist, Nan Xian Source Night. He was ruthless, black-bellied, and affectionate. He loved Su Zijin alone. The female protagonist, Su Zijin, was a chatterbox. She loved to be sarcastic and only loved His Highness the Wargod. This book can be read on Qidian Chinese website. " Wargod Consort's Words Are Many " Author: Ah Lahu. It's an ancient romance novel. It's finished and you can enjoy it without worry. User recommendation: [End of full text] [Tea Words Tea Words Female Lead vs Horny Black Male Lead] Su Zijin was accidentally sent to the book world by the system to be the evil female supporting character in the book because she was complaining about a palace novel. The system told Su Zijin that she could change the plot at will and was not bound by any plot! Since she could change the plot, then she had to send her Prince Charming Zhan Wangye to the throne! Su Zijin,"Your Highness, don't be afraid. I'll clear the obstacles for you!" "Princess Consort, I'm counting on you." It was only later that Su Zijin realized that her Prince Charming had been reborn! Zhan Wang Ye: My princess consort is weak and can't take care of herself. Please don't bully her at will. The ministers thought,"Your Highness, you must be blind…" I hope you will like this book.
